Controversial Release: Hotel Manager Accused of Wife’s Murder Raises Questions About Justice System

The release of a hotel manager, who stands accused of murdering his wife, has sparked protests from the deceased’s family and friends. It has also raised questions about the credibility of the criminal justice system.

Paul Musisi, a 28-year-old individual, is the suspect in question, serving as the manager of Muzza Hotel in Mukono town. The victim in this case is his late wife, Shadia Nangobi.

Musisi, a resident of Namubiru Village in Nama sub-county, was initially arrested on November 27, 2023, in connection with the death of his wife. He was released later on December 2, 2023.

Although the bond is considered a legal right in many jurisdictions, as it is linked to the broader principle of the presumption of innocence until proven guilty, the circumstances surrounding his release have left the public in disbelief.

The family of the deceased, led by Shadia’s father, Sadah Karimu, alleges that the police have conspired with Musisi to obstruct justice.

According to Karimu, during the examination of Shadia’s body before burial, they discovered disturbing details.

The body reportedly lacked a tongue, and private parts showed deep cuts, with a piece of cloth forcibly placed inside. These revelations have intensified suspicions and fueled the family’s accusations against Musisi.

In Musisi’s statement to the police, on the night of November 26, 2023, he returned home and found no response from his wife. 

He returned the next morning, and broke into their home, only to discover Shadia’s lifeless body in one of the bedrooms. Musisi promptly reported the incident to the police.

Kampala Metropolitan Police Spokesperson, Patrick Onyango, stated that upon police examination, it was suspected that Shadia might have been strangled, leading to her death. 

The body was subsequently taken to Mulago City Mortuary for a post-mortem. According to Onyango, the postmortem report indicated that Shadia died of suffocation.

Despite the apparent evidence pointing to a suspicious death, the sequence of events takes a bewildering turn with Musisi’s release. Onyango explained that the case file was submitted to the State Attorney, who advised further inquiries. 

The State Attorney recommended retrieving a toxicology report from the forensic laboratory before resubmitting the file for guidance.

However, the family of the deceased claims they were not informed about Musisi’s release and accuses the police of failing to update them on the investigation’s findings.

However, the family members of the deceased contend that Musisi’s release has the potential to interfere with ongoing investigations, and they express concern that justice for their daughter may not be served.

Anonymous police sources disclosed that a senior officer from the Uganda People’s Defense Forces (UPDF), along with members of the district security committee, influenced Musisi’s release. 

Allegedly, this influential team has engaged with the State Attorney’s office to navigate the legal proceedings.

The suspect’s background adds another layer of complexity to the case. Musisi is the son of Wilson Mukiibi Muzzanganda, a prominent Mengo royalist and businessman in Kikuubo.

Muzzanganda’s considerable wealth has seemingly played a role in supporting efforts to clear his son of all accusations.

Community sentiments reflect a mixed reaction to Musisi’s release. While some express concerns about the circumstances, others within the Mukono community are not necessarily against the release but demand transparency in the process.

There is a growing call for the police to update the bereaved family on all findings from the investigation.

Efforts to contact Musisi since his release have been unsuccessful, as he reportedly went into hiding.

As the controversy surrounding this case deepens, it raises profound questions about the fairness and transparency of the criminal justice system in Uganda.

The community awaits further developments as authorities navigate the particulars of this unsettling case.
